Output bb2331794f54fa3a90d0729e2a4f970c87012e157725bf9dbb602034c6c54022:0

value
70436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28d7235dd7989c6b5cbfe366a43e77857bb7c86a OP_EQUAL
address
35QxgH4ZJfyEkVBZHqPUygAiKgv7sEKGuE
transaction
bb2331794f54fa3a90d0729e2a4f970c87012e157725bf9dbb602034c6c54022
spent
true